What is ctan-cm-lgc-fonts-common
The CM-LGC PostScript Type 1 fonts are converted from the METAFONT sources of the Computer Modern font families. CM-LGC supports the T1, T2A, LGR, and TS1 encodings, i.e. Latin, Cyrillic, and Greek. This package consists of files used by other ctan-cm-lgc-fonts packages.

Install ctan-cm-lgc-fonts-common on Fedora 36 Using dnf
Update yum database with dnf
using the following command.
sudo dnf makecache --refresh
After updating yum database, We can install ctan-cm-lgc-fonts-common
using dnf
by running the following command:
sudo dnf -y install ctan-cm-lgc-fonts-common
